YOUR ROLE

Join Henkel’s Digital Transformation and contribute to our commitment to Sustainability

  • Close collaboration with colleagues in other countries of region 
  • Preparation for a fast-track development in the organization to become our leaders of the future
  • 18-month trainee program providing a broad overview of the role and tasks of operations and Supply Chain management at Henkel Adhesive Technologies
  • Three phases of 6 months, including responsible tasks and projects in the production in our plants, to build a deep insight into the different functions of Operations and Supply Chain through rotations and able involve in cross functional projects. 
  • Introduction to different Supply Chain and related functions like digital business,procurement, and sales to build a broad understanding of the organization
  • During the program you will benefit from:
    • Individual trainings, development plans, a  high level of visibility, mentor’s guidance, network with senior leaders and other trainees globally.
    • Permanent contract, a competitive salary, and a guaranteed position after the program based on satisfying performance
  • Upon completion of the program, you will be placed in a responsible position across the operations and Supply Chain organization at one of our regional locations where the knowledge and expertise learned through the program will provide you with a wide range of career opportunities

YOUR SKILLS

  • Bachelor’s degree in Engineering (Chemical, Industrial, or Mechanical) with a successful academic record
  • Fresh graduate (or up to2 years of work experience), ideally within a multinational environment
  • Eager to learn, with interest in new technologies, digitization and data analysis 
  • Excellent verbal and written communication skillsin English with the ability to interact effectively with all levels of management
  • Strong verbal and written communication skills in the local language
  • Strong problem-solving and analytical capabilities
  • Advanced knowledge of MS Office
  • Great aptitude for continuous learning and self-development
  • Geographic mobility
